About Sabrina Alexander

Sabrina Alexander is a Florida-licensed therapist with five years of professional experience. She holds an LCSW, which means Licensed Clinical Social Worker, reflecting specialized training in clinical social work and direct client care.

Her practice focuses on helping people manage stress and anxiety, work through family conflicts, cope with grief and loss, and regain motivation, self-esteem, and confidence. She emphasizes a respectful, sensitive, and compassionate approach to each person she meets.

Sabrina adapts conversations and treatment plans to the specific needs of each client, recognizing that every situation is different. She acknowledges that taking the first step toward a more fulfilling and happier life takes courage, and she aims to provide steady support throughout that process.

Could Virtual Sessions Fit Your Needs?

Many people wonder whether online therapy can truly help. For many common concerns - such as stress, anxiety, depression, relationship challenges, or navigating life changes - online therapy can be as effective as traditional in-person sessions.

One of the primary benefits is flexibility. Clients can connect with therapists in the format that feels most comfortable - video calls, phone sessions, live chat, or in-app messaging - making it easier to fit care into a busy schedule.

Licensed professionals offer online services, and clients have the option to switch therapists if they want a different fit. For those balancing work, family, or other responsibilities, remote therapy can provide a practical way to access consistent support.
